| Commit message (Expand) | Author | Age | Files | Lines |
* |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 157 | Thomas Gleixner | 2019-05-30 | 1 | -9/+1 |
* | locking/lock_events: Make lock_events available for all archs & other locks | Waiman Long | 2019-04-10 | 1 | -129/+12 |
* | locking/qspinlock_stat: Introduce generic lockevent_*() counting APIs | Waiman Long | 2019-04-10 | 1 | -101/+62 |
* | locking/qspinlock_stat: Track the no MCS node available case | Waiman Long | 2019-02-04 | 1 | -6/+15 |
* | locking/qspinlock_stat: Count instances of nested lock slowpaths | Waiman Long | 2018-10-17 | 1 | -0/+6 |
* | locking/qspinlock: Add stat tracking for pending vs. slowpath | Waiman Long | 2018-04-27 | 1 | -3/+6 |
* | sched/headers: Prepare for new header dependencies before moving code to <lin... | Ingo Molnar | 2017-03-02 | 1 | -0/+1 |
* | don't open-code file_inode() | Al Viro | 2016-12-05 | 1 | -10/+2 |
* | locking/pvstat: Separate wait_again and spurious wakeup stats | Waiman Long | 2016-08-10 | 1 | -2/+2 |
* | locking/pvqspinlock: Fix a bug in qstat_read() | Pan Xinhui | 2016-08-10 | 1 | -1/+0 |
* | locking/pvqspinlock: Robustify init_qspinlock_stat() | Davidlohr Bueso | 2016-05-05 | 1 | -8/+14 |
* | locking/pvqspinlock: Avoid double resetting of stats | Davidlohr Bueso | 2016-05-05 | 1 | -2/+0 |
* | locking/pvqspinlock: Fix division by zero in qstat_read() | Davidlohr Bueso | 2016-04-19 | 1 | -3/+5 |
* | locking/pvqspinlock: Enable slowpath locking count tracking | Waiman Long | 2016-02-29 | 1 | -0/+3 |
* | locking/pvqspinlock: Move lock stealing count tracking code into pv_queued_sp... | Waiman Long | 2016-02-29 | 1 | -13/+0 |
* | locking/pvqspinlock: Queue node adaptive spinning | Waiman Long | 2015-12-04 | 1 | -0/+3 |
* | locking/pvqspinlock: Allow limited lock stealing | Waiman Long | 2015-12-04 | 1 | -0/+16 |
* | locking/pvqspinlock: Collect slowpath lock statistics | Waiman Long | 2015-12-04 | 1 | -0/+281 |